Key Responsibilities
The Physical Therapist will provide home and community-based early intervention services to infants and toddlers with developmental delays. They will collaborate with families to develop and implement Individual Family Service Plans while facilitating child development and parent-child interactions.
Requirements
Candidates must hold a current Massachusetts Physical Therapist license and possess knowledge of early childhood development. Experience working with infants, toddlers, and families is preferred, along with strong organizational and communication skills.
